Nelly Rams Are 'On Loaner' In L.A. ... Still STL's Team!
Nelly doesn't hate the Rams for leaving St. Louis -- he's still rooting for 'em ... assuring TMZ Sports they're just "on loan" to L.A. for the time being.
Yeah, don't hold your breath ...
The Rams are killin' it right now -- they're 3-0 and Jared Goff and Todd Gurley are playing out of their minds.
So, when we saw the STL rapper at Mastro's in Bev Hills on Wednesday night -- we had to ask if he's still backing his boys in blue and white.
That's when Nelly reminded us where his team REALLY belongs.
"They're on loaner out here," Nelly said ... "They're on loaner out here. They're on LOANER out here, man!"
We got it. Loaner. Out here.
By the way, back when the Rams announced the move in 2016, Nelly told us he thinks the team should change the team colors and leave the blue and gold to STL.
The team actually has plans to do that -- but league rules slowed down the process. Expect new threads by 2020.

Yasiel Puig Terrifying Burglary Video Shows Scumbags Ransacking Bedroom
Here's frightening footage from INSIDE Yasiel Puig's bedroom -- capturing the moment two burglars raided the MLB star's L.A. home last week and ripped the place apart searching for his safe.
The footage was shot by a surveillance camera which appears to be hidden from the burglars. You can hear the alarm blaring in the background as the crooks tear through drawers looking for valuables.
After going under the bed and raiding the closet, one of the dirtbags locates Puig's safe on the side of the room and yells for his pal to come over and help him crack it open.
It proved too tough of a job -- and they fled the scene without being able to unlock it or boost it out of the house.
The burglary took place on Tuesday Sept. 18 -- while Puig was at Dodger Stadium taking on the Colorado Rockies. Seems the bad guys knew Puig would be out of the home.
As we reported ... it's the 4th time Puig's home has been hit in the past 2 years.
There's more security footage ... Puig's Ring system at his door captured the guys donkey kicking their way into the home before they made their way to the bedroom.
As we reported ... another unwanted visitor stopped off at Yasiel's crib just a few days ago, but luckily someone was home to intercept them and alert the authorities.

NHL's Jori Lehtera Questioned Over Cocaine Ring ... In Finland
Philadelphia Flyers forward Jori Lehtera is DENYING any involvement with a suspected Finnish coke ring -- after authorities raided a cottage he owns in his home country.
Details are sketchy at this point, but Finnish news outlets say 7 people have already been locked up in connection to the suspected drug ring.
Local news outlets are saying cops are focusing on 2 kilos of cocaine (worth about $25k each). Unclear if they found the load during the raids or if that's what they suspect is being distributed.
Officials have reportedly seized more than $700,000 in jewelry and other valuables and have more than 23 persons of interest in the case.
30-year-old Jori was not at the cottage when it was raided over the summer. No charges have been filed against him and he's reportedly denied all wrongdoing.
Jori is a decent NHL player. He's in the middle of a 3-year, $14.1 million contract.
Flyers GM and former NHL goalie Ron Hextall released a statement Wednesday morning, saying “We have spoken with Jori Lehtera and the league office regarding the reports out of Finland, and will reserve any further comment on the matter at this time.”
